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black-collared Lovebird | tree hydroid |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(สัตว์) | Animalia (สัตว์) |
| Phylum | Chordata (สัตว์มีแกนสันหลัง) | Cnidaria (ไนดาเรีย) |
| Class | Aves (นก) | Hydrozoa (ไฮโดรซัว) |
| Order | Psittaciformes (อันดับนกแก้ว) | Anthoathecata (Anthoathecata) |
| Family | Psittacidae (True Parrots) | Eudendriidae |
| Genus | Agapornis | Eudendrium |
| Species | Agapornis swindernianus | Eudendrium ramosum |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black-collared Lovebird and tree hydroid share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(สัตว์)
